What is the PE ratio of Capitol Federal Financial (CFFN) stock?

The PE (Price to Earnings) ratio of Capitol Federal Financial (CFFN) is currently 14.73. This metric is used to evaluate the valuation of a company's stock, comparing its current share price relative to its per-share earnings.
help

What is the EPS of Capitol Federal Financial (CFFN) stock?

The Earnings Per Share (EPS) for Capitol Federal Financial (CFFN), calculated on a diluted basis, is $0.39. EPS is a key indicator of a company's profitability, showing the portion of a company's profit allocated to each outstanding share of common stock.
help

What is the operating margin of Capitol Federal Financial (CFFN) stock?

The operating margin for Capitol Federal Financial (CFFN) is 43.54%. This metric represents the percentage of revenue that remains after paying for variable production costs, indicating the efficiency and profitability of the company's core business operations.

How much debt does Capitol Federal Financial (CFFN) have?

Capitol Federal Financial (CFFN) has a total debt of $2.16B. The net debt, which accounts for cash and cash equivalents against the total debt, is $1.99B.
